The next full lighting of WaterFire will be Saturday, August 18th. The fires will be lit shortly after sunset (7:42 p.m.) and remain lit until MIDNIGHT.

This WaterFire lighting is sponsored by: Fidelity Investments & the Northeast Chapter of the American Association of Airport Executives

There are a lot of exciting special events at this weekend’s WaterFire.

6:15pm – 7:57pm – Capoeira Group performs on the Basin Stage 

  • Enjoy the Afro-Brazilian martial art of Grupo Ondas that combines fighting, dancing, acrobatics, and music into a “game” that is as breath-taking to watch as it is to play!

7:00pm – Midnight at the TD Bank Ballroom: Salsa Night!

  • 7:00 – 8:00pm: Join us for a salsa lesson by Tony Felix and Jeannie Oki
  • 8:00 – Midnight: Enjoy LIVE music by Ray Rivera con Sabor Latino and dance performances by groups Mambo Pa Ti andSalsa y Control

7:30pm – Bolivian Performers on the Confluence (off of Steeple St. bridge)

10:15pm – 10:30pm – Salsa performance on the Basin stage

  • Raices Latin Dance group will perform to the WaterFire soundtrack
